Restaurant Summary

The room feels like a lived-in Neukölln apartment with a mezzanine perch and blue benches out front, a space that regulars call cozy and unpretentious. Staff interactions split opinion: some find them warm and helpful, others report brusque moments, but many still come for the atmosphere and specialty coffee that several describe as the best in the area. The cooking centers on craft coffee, simple sandwiches, and house bakes with several vegan options rather than culinary theatrics. Expect solid espresso drinks, a lauded grilled cheese and cinnamon roll, and a few items that can feel pricey for the portion. This suits coffee-focused visits and casual catch-ups more than full-on meals; quality is praised, though milk texturing and temperature have been inconsistent at times. Families will find accessible choices like croissants, cakes, and hot chocolate, plus outdoor seating when the sun is out. There is no kids menu noted, and weekends enforce a no-laptop policy, which keeps tables open but may limit teens hoping to work. Weekdays offer designated laptop spots, making it easier for parents to relax while kids snack.
